codificação legal & recursos de Ciência da computação para adolescentes
codificação é a linguagem do século 21. Mesmo que você nunca vá para uma carreira em TI, engenharia elétrica ou programação de computadores, todo mundo precisa saber o básico. E não tome apenas a minha palavra para isso! Ouça o que essas pessoas famosas têm a dizer sobre isso:
então, o que você pode fazer com a codificação? Você pode…
- A área de estudo
- fazer um filme
- design de arte
- tornar a educação mais divertida
- design de uma nova tendência de moda
- melhorar a saúde
- contribuir para a ciência real projectos
- fazer o seu próprio jogo de vídeo
- ensinar seu computador para fazer sua lição de casa
- tornar um aplicativo
- o design de um website
- operar um robô
- prever o tempo
- programa uma canção
E muito mais! Se você gosta de esportes ou arte, jogos ou moda, você pode fazer tantas coisas diferentes com codificação. Então, como você aprende a codificar? Aprender a codificar é bem simples e você pode dominar o básico em uma hora.
Ferramentas legais para Começar a Aprender informática
por Claire Zhu
a Mergulhar no mundo da ciência da computação como um novato é surpreendente, mas fascinante mesmo. Como geralmente acontece com todas as coisas tecnologia, há um fluxo enorme e constante de informações – tantas coisas novas para aprender, ver, estudar. Pode definitivamente parecer um pouco intimidante ou esmagadora no início, e você pode encontrar-se levemente confuso sobre por onde exatamente começar.
nunca tenha medo! Existem toneladas de plataformas interessantes, úteis e gratuitas para iniciar seu aprendizado e dar-lhe prática prática para avançar em sua jornada de ciência da computação:
1. Codecademy
Codecademy tem uma tonelada de grande material de aprendizagem para apresentar a você os conceitos básicos de linguagens de codificação, carreiras e outros assuntos interessantes, como desenvolvimento de jogos e visualização de dados. Também inclui questionários para testar suas novas habilidades e projetos exclusivos relacionados a cenários da vida real.
os cursos variam de Iniciantes A níveis intermediários, o que é perfeito para alguém que está começando. Ele desenvolve os fundamentos necessários para fornecer uma base robusta para um aprendizado mais avançado e aprofundado.
2. Khan Academy
Khan Academy é uma plataforma educacional que parece ter tudo. Para a Ciência da computação, há toneladas de vídeos e artigos que são incrivelmente detalhados e completos. Os exercícios interativos são divertidos e criativos, e os guias de personagens de desenhos animados caprichosos proporcionam alguma diversão ao seu aprendizado.
existem cursos introdutórios e avançados para todos os tipos de alunos. Os cursos apresentam muitos aplicativos do mundo real, como armazenamento de informações on-line, Internet e segurança de dados.
3. freeCodeCamp
freeCodeCamp tem mais de 7.000 tutoriais que ajudam você a aprender todos os tipos de linguagens de codificação e são todos, como o nome diz, completamente grátis! Existem cursos sobre web design com HTML e CSS, algoritmos JavaScript, desenvolvimento front-end com Bootstrap e React, análise de dados com Python e muitos, muitos mais. Cada tutorial começa com o básico, progredindo gradualmente em direção a tópicos mais complexos à medida que você desenvolve suas habilidades. Há também projetos finais incluídos para desafiar suas novas habilidades e provar a si mesmo, e ao mundo, que você está realmente codificando!
4. W3Schools
w3schools inclui tutoriais, referências, exercícios e cursos para quase todas as linguagens de codificação existentes. Cada tutorial explica os recursos dos idiomas e seu uso e fornece muitos exercícios e questionários para a prática. Além disso, também existem tutoriais sobre Desenvolvimento web, inteligência artificial e armazenamento de dados. No momento em que você conseguir terminar um curso e todos os exercícios correspondentes, você se tornará um profissional experiente no idioma.
5. SoloLearn
SoloLearn é um recurso simples e fácil para iniciantes que procuram aprender a estrutura de uma nova linguagem de programação do zero. Existem cursos sobre uma variedade de tópicos, incluindo C# e ciência de dados, bem como um playground de codificação que permite mais liberdade para projetos independentes separados. Dê uma olhada em alguns dos códigos postados por outros alunos para se inspirar! SoloLearn oferece uma grande oportunidade para mais prática e escovar acima em seu conhecimento, e promete que “você estará escrevendo o código real, funcional dentro de minutos de começar seu primeiro curso.”
6. CodePen é um editor de código online onde você pode criar pequenos trechos de código, ou “canetas”, testá-los e compartilhá-los com uma grande e amigável comunidade de desenvolvedores. É conveniente, acessível e oferece muita liberdade para praticar e experimentar os novos idiomas que você aprendeu. Se você não sabe por onde começar, explore as canetas “tendências” ou dê uma olhada em alguns dos desafios dessa centelha de inspiração. Não só é divertido e emocionante, mas é particularmente empoderador colocar suas habilidades à prova e produzir algo incrível que você não poderia apenas alguns minutos antes.
7. Replit
Replit, semelhante ao CodePen, é um site onde os usuários podem codificar e criar aplicativos ou sites em seu navegador. Ele inclui muitos modelos e tutoriais diferentes de outros colaboradores em linguagens de codificação e construção de programas legais, como um jogo clicker ou uma animação. Ele ainda tem recursos colaborativos para equipes de vários usuários trabalharem juntas em qualquer projeto. É um ótimo recurso para usuários iniciantes e avançados e tem uma comunidade acolhedora que está aberta a espalhar seus conhecimentos.Começar sua jornada de codificação é definitivamente mais do que um pouco assustador, mas isso não deve desencorajá-lo de perseguir seu interesse. Não só há uma enorme variedade de recursos disponíveis para você, mas há toneladas de comunidades cheias de pessoas que compartilharam experiências semelhantes e estão dispostas a ajudar de qualquer maneira que puderem. Então, vá lá e aprenda e fique sempre curioso.